What companies run services between Chesham, Buckinghamshire, England and Shaftesbury Avenue, England?

London Underground (Tube) operates a subway from Chesham station to Baker Street station every 20 minutes. Tickets cost £21–85 and the journey takes 56 min. Alternatively, you can take a bus from Underground Station to Shaftesbury Avenue via Harrow-on-the-Hill Station, Harrow Bus Station, and Haymarket / Charles II Street in around 2h 52m.
